First, the Hadley Cell circulation is constant. Second, the air moving toward the poles in the upper atmosphere conserves its axial angular momentum, while the surface air moving equatorwards is slowed down by friction. Vallis ch. 2.8, Kundu and Cohen ch. 14.5, Gill ch. 7.7) The thermal wind name originates from the application of these equations to atmospheric dynamics, where the velocities are the wind and density is mostly a function of temperature. But the balance is just as important to oceanic dynamics. In both the atmosphere and ocean, thermal wind enabled …

WebThe solar wind is a weakly collisional ionized gas experiencing collective effects due to long-range electromagnetic forces. Unlike a collisionally mediated fluid like Earth’s atmosphere, the solar wind is not in thermodynamic or thermal equilibrium.
